Output 7584fac01d68fe8424c8cec2f71a5ede524fda55295ecd5a40beda374572eb3a:0

value
94974711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da464d344eedc69ea43a08e47b4013cd4f0aaf1f OP_EQUAL
address
MToHktVUKoicCSmNfMvgq8EtLaT4jGAXEm
transaction
7584fac01d68fe8424c8cec2f71a5ede524fda55295ecd5a40beda374572eb3a
spent
true